UFO Data Insights

GitHub Pages

A static demo site hosting dozens of interactive D3.js visualizations of UFO sighting data. Originally developed by students in USC Data Science courses (primarily DSCI 550 / CSCI 599 Spring 2018) under the direction of Dr. Chris Mattmann as part of the USC Information Retrieval and Data Science (IRDS) Group.

The site demonstrates data collection, enrichment (joining public datasets, OCR on British MoD files, deep learning for image captioning/object recognition via Apache Tika + TensorFlow), similarity analysis (Tika-Similarity), and rich client-side visualization — all made fully self-contained for easy deployment and local viewing.

Quick Start (Local)

# From the repo root
python3 -m http.server

# Then open http://localhost:8000/
# or http://localhost:8000/html/d3-examples.html for the full gallery

No build step, no external dependencies, no servers required. All data is vendored or synthetic where original backends (Solr/ES) were used.

Key Features & Student Work

  • Data Enrichment (HW1/HW2 style): Joining UFO sightings with airports, population, weather, etc. + OCR on British UFO files + image analysis with Tika + Inception models.
  • Similarity & Clustering: Tika-Similarity (Jaccard, cosine, edit distance), dendrograms, circle packing.
  • Interactive D3 Visualizations: Maps (choropleth, dot), timelines, word clouds, gauges, bubbles, circos, radar, heatmaps, image similarity search (MEMEX ImageSpace/ImageCat), Solr-backed dynamic views (now static), and more.
  • Consistent Branding: USC/IRDS top navbar on all team pages (Home → /index.html#page-top, About, Insights, Search, Partners). Iframe loading pattern used on complex hubs so the outer nav is never lost.
  • Self-Contained Demo: Absolute paths, vendored d3.v3/v4 + topojson, no CDNs, works offline after python -m http.server.
